SUMMARY:Region 5 - 40 Hour Hostage/Crisis Negotiation Course - Odessa
DESCRIPTION:WHEN:  September 8\, 2025 to September 12\, 2025 \nCOST:  $300.00 (Includes 1 year TAHN Membership) \nThis 40 hour course introduces the skillsets to prepare Law Enforcement personnel to become crisis/hostage negotiators.  Upon completing this course\, the new negotiator will have an essential understanding of team roles in crisis/hostage negotiations and should be able to perform any hostage negotiator team member role.  This course meets standards set forth by TCOLE and by the State of Texas for wiretap warrants.  The class cost is $300 which includes a 1-year TAHN membership. \nThis course covers the following and more: \n\nHistory of Negotiations\nCharacteristics of a Negotiable Incident and Stages of an Incident\nActive Listening and Communication Skills\nHandling Demands\, Effects of Time\nRecognizing Psychological\, Mental and Emotional Disorders\, how to recognize them and deal with them\, including Stockholm Syndrome\nThe Effects of Stress\, Stages of Stress and Stress in the Hostage Situation\nTeam Structure\nIntelligence Coordination\nA full day of Realistic Scenarios and Scenario Training\n\nThis training is being provided to local\, state and federal law enforcement personnel which includes law enforcement officers/agents\, peace officers\, detention/corrections officers or communications officers who have a demonstrated professional interest in hostage/crisis negotiations.  Identification will be required showing your affiliation with a federal\, state or local law enforcement agency at the beginning of the training.

SUMMARY:Region 1 Strategic Communications Class – Mesquite
DESCRIPTION:This course gives first responders the essential skills for effective communication in high-pressure situations as well as their day to day conversations. Topics include rapport building\, mastering communication techniques\, and gaining the trust of individuals in crisis. Through interactive sessions and practical exercises\, participants will learn to navigate complex interactions and achieve positive outcomes. This class is a great introduction into the art of negotiations and established negotiators can benefit as well from the refresher on the fundamental communication skills used in negotiations.
